A Oxford Book of English Poetry

An anthology containing a wide selection of poems in the English language, The Oxford Book of English Poetry holds as a monumental achievement in literary history. Edited by eminent poet and critic Sir Arthur Quiller-Couch, the volume covers centuries of English poetic expression, from medieval ballads to the works of modern masters. Each poem in The Oxford Book of English Poetry is carefully chosen for its literary merit and its impact on the development of English poetry.

Scholars will discover within these pages a diverse tapestry of voices, delving into themes of love, loss, nature, war, and the mortal condition. The Oxford Book of English Poetry is an crucial resource for anyone passionate for the history and beauty of English poetry.
